Chelsea's victory against Aston Villa, secured by goals from Nicolas Jackson, Enzo Fernandez, and Cole Palmer, propels them to joint second in the Premier League table alongside Arsenal. The match took place at Stamford Bridge on December 1, 2024, with Jackson, Fernandez, and Palmer contributing to the 3-0 scoreline.

Chelsea took advantage of questionable defending in the 36th minute when Fernandez was fed by Palmer before steadying himself and firing home between Matty Cash and Ezri Konsa.
